Why it goes wrong

Wash and fold fails on the boring things

Nobody loses a customer over the wash. They lose them over a missing sock, a bag that arrives damp, or a slot that moves without warning.

  • Loads get mixed

    Two households' laundry batched into one machine to fill it is how items go missing and colours run. Each order runs as its own load — that is what 'up to 6kg' and 'up to 12kg' actually mean.

  • The slot moves

    A collection window that shifts by a day is worse than a slower promise kept. Slots are fixed rounds, not a driver's best guess, because the same van is already serving commercial accounts on that street.

  • It comes back damp

    Under-dried laundry folded into a bag smells within hours. Everything is dried to finish and folded warm, not packed to meet a van.

How it runs

Five steps, and one bag

The same sequence for a student's weekly load and a café's aprons.

If something is missing We look Every load is logged in and out by weight
  1. Collection

    Picked up on the existing round in our own van, in your bag or ours.

    06:00–01:00, Mon–Sat

  2. Weighed and logged

    Weighed at the plant, so the price you were quoted is the price on the invoice. Over 6kg simply moves to the next band at £3.14 a kilo.

    Before anything is washed

  3. Washed at 30°C

    Mixed is lights and darks together. Separated runs them apart — £33.93 for up to 12kg, which is two loads, not one bigger one.

    Mixed or separated

  4. Dried and folded

    Dried fully, folded warm and packed. Ironing is included on the Premium and Elite subscriptions, extra otherwise.

    Dried to finish

  5. Back on the round

    Returned on the same round that collected it. 24 hours on Premium, same-day on Elite.

    48 hours standard

Turnaround is from collection, not from when the bag reaches the plant.

When a subscription beats the load rate

The arithmetic, not the pitch.

  1. Under 6kg a week

    Pay per load

    One mixed wash is £16.97. Below about one load a week, paying as you go is cheaper than any plan.

  2. 10kg a week

    Household Lite, £25

    Two 6kg loads at the per-load rate would be £33.94. Lite covers 10kg for £25 with a fixed weekly slot.

  3. 20kg a week

    Household Premium, £40

    Ironing included and 24-hour turnaround. At the per-load rate the same weight is well over £60 before ironing.

We will tell you if the per-load rate is cheaper for you. It often is.

Wash and fold, answered

How much is wash and fold in London?

A mixed wash up to 6kg is £16.97 and a separated wash up to 12kg is £33.93. Each additional kilo is £3.14.

If it is weekly, subscriptions start at £25 for 10kg. All of it is on the price list.

Is there a minimum order?

No. One bag is fine.

Your load rides a round that already serves your street for commercial accounts, so there is no surcharge for being a household or for collecting a single bag.

Is ironing included?

Not on the per-load rate or on Household Lite. It is included on Household Premium (£40) and Elite (£60), and can be added to any order.

What if something needs dry cleaning instead?

Anything structured or delicate goes on the dry cleaning list instead — suits from £13.46, overcoats from £14.36.

Both can go in the same collection; they are separated at the plant.

Can I pause a subscription?

Yes — paused rather than cancelled.

Most people asking to cancel are going away for a few weeks, not leaving, so pausing keeps your slot and your rate.

What is the difference between a mixed and a separate wash?

Mixed washes lights and darks together in one load at 30°C. Separate runs them apart.

Separate is two loads, not one bigger one — which is why up to 12kg is £33.93.

How long does it take?

48 hours from collection as standard. 24 hours on Household Premium, same-day on Elite.

The clock starts at collection, not when the bag reaches Wembley.

Do you wash my laundry with other people's?

No. Each order runs as its own load.

That is what the weight bands actually mean: 6kg is your 6kg, not a share of a bigger machine filled with someone else's clothes.

Can businesses use wash and fold?

Yes. The Café Wash & Fold plan is £49 a week for up to 20 aprons and 30 tea towels, with daily or twice-weekly collection and coffee and oil stain treatment.

Offices, hostels and Airbnb hosts use the same service on their own plans.
